Record-Breaking Rise in Short Interest

AOT Growth & Innovation ETF (NASDAQ:AOTG) has witnessed a sensational growth in short interest, capturing the attention of financial analysts and investors alike. As stated in Defense World, the short interest in AOTG skyrocketed by an extraordinary 485.7% as of April 15th, with the total shares sold short reaching a remarkable 4,100. Just a couple of weeks prior, on March 31st, there were only 700 shares in short interest. This explosive increase is a clear indicator of the volatility looming over the ETF’s future performance.

On Friday, AOTG shares opened at a modest price of \(40.74. Despite facing ups and downs, the business has maintained a 50-day moving average price of \)40.21 and a 200-day moving average of \(43.69. The recent fluctuations have not deterred the long-term market cap, which still holds a significant value of \)46.85 million. Insight into AOTG’s Strategy

AOT Growth & Innovation ETF invests predominantly in low marginal cost companies across the US, focusing on promising growth ventures. Managed by Alpha Architect, AOTG’s approach employs proprietary fundamental research to identify key opportunities. Launched on June 29, 2022, the ETF aims to balance innovation with strategic market positioning.
